Number of cars per household

Analysis of car ownership in 2021, indicates 72% of households in Wandong - Heathcote Junction area had access to two or more motor vehicles, compared to 70% in Puckapunyal.

The ability of the population to access services and employment is strongly influenced by access to transport. The number of motor vehicles per household in Wandong - Heathcote Junction area quantifies access to private transport and will be influenced by Age Structure and Household Type, which determine the number of adults present; access to Public Transport; distance to shops, services, employment and education; and Household Income. Depending on these factors, car ownership can be seen as a measure of advantage or disadvantage, or a neutral socio-economic measure, which impacts on the environment and quality of life.

Derived from the Census question:

'How many registered motor vehicles owned or used by residents of this dwelling were garaged or parked at or near this dwelling on the night of 10 August 2021?'

Dominant groups

Analysis of the car ownership of the households in Wandong - Heathcote Junction area in 2021 compared to Puckapunyal shows that 88.3% of the households owned at least one car, while 0.8% did not, compared with 94.7% and 2.1% respectively in Puckapunyal.

Of those that owned at least one vehicle, there was a smaller proportion who owned just one car; a smaller proportion who owned two cars; and a larger proportion who owned three cars or more.

Overall, 15.9% of the households owned one car; 34.2% owned two cars; and 38.3% owned three cars or more, compared with 24.3%; 59.3% and 11.1% respectively for Puckapunyal.

Emerging groups

There were no major differences in Wandong - Heathcote Junction area between 2016 and 2021.
